Activities promote Vietnam-Japan cultural exchanges

Thirty-two students from 14 countries throughout the world, including Vietnam, participated in the English Summer Camp in the Japanese central prefecture of Shiga from August 21- 27. Organised by the Kumon Education Institute since 2001, the annual event aims to help local primary pupils improve their English skills and understanding of world cultures, including Vietnamese [...]

Vietnam joins Super Yosakoi festival in Japan

The “Yosakoi – 1,000 years of Hanoi” team of Vietnam participated in the 2011 Harajuku Omotesando Super Yosakoi Festival held in Tokyo on August 27-28.    In the framework of the festival, the team performed on three major stages and took part in stress processions. Conference on Tourism Property Management to Open in HCMC

The Conference on Tourism Property Management is set to open at Legend Saigon Hotel, Ho Chi Minh City on September 15, 2010. Some 100 representatives of companies managing hotels, resorts and serviced apartments as well as consulting and design companies, tax and law consultants are expected to attend the event, according to the organizing board. Sam Mountain

Travelling almost 6km to the west of Chau Doc Town, An Giang Province, you will have a chance to view the 230m-high Sam Mountain with beautiful landscapes and many historic remains. Sam Mountain is the highest mountain in the Mekong Delta. On the way there, you can enjoy the sights of the two rice fields [...]
